The Parts of a Water Heater a Contractor Checks First

Isometric cutaway illustration of a single-story house with a dark shingled roof, showing interior rooms with furniture, a bathroom with tub and sink, and a cylindrical water heater connected to pipes and a vertical flue extending through the roof.

The tank is the center of the system, sitting in a utility space, basement, or closet, and its job is to hold and heat a supply of water ready for use. The burner assembly or heating element sits inside or beneath the tank and is often where a repair starts, since a failure there stops hot water production entirely.

The pressure relief valve mounts on the side of the tank and releases pressure if it climbs too high. The anode rod hangs inside the tank to slow corrosion, and the dip tube runs down through the water to direct cold supply toward the heat source. The inlet and outlet connections at the top carry cold water in and hot water out to the rest of the house.

The drawing shows a typical layout, and a licensed contractor determines which parts apply to the specific unit and installation in your home.

Licensing Rules for HVAC Repair in Morgan County, Illinois

Illinois leaves HVAC licensing to the municipality: state law lets the corporate authorities of each city or village examine, license and regulate heating, air conditioning and refrigeration contractors, and caps the licence fee they may charge at $50 — so who licenses you depends on the town you work in.
